Job Description :

DevOps Infrastructure Engineer

100% Remote

Job Summary:

We are seeking a skilled DevOps Infrastructure Engineer to design, implement, and maintain scalable, secure, and highly available infrastructure. The ideal candidate will work closely with development, QA, and operations teams to streamline CI/CD pipelines, automate deployments, and optimize cloud infrastructure performance.


Key Responsibilities:

  • Design, build, and maintain cloud-based infrastructure (AWS/Azure/GCP).

  • Implement and manage CI/CD pipelines for automated build, test, and deployment processes.

  • Automate infrastructure provisioning using Infrastructure as Code (IaC) tools like Terraform, CloudFormation, or ARM templates.

  • Monitor system performance, availability, and reliability using tools like Prometheus, Grafana, or CloudWatch.

  • Ensure security best practices, including access controls, vulnerability management, and compliance.

  • Troubleshoot infrastructure issues and provide root cause analysis.

  • Collaborate with development teams to improve deployment strategies and system scalability.

  • Manage containerization and orchestration platforms like Docker and Kubernetes.

  • Maintain version control systems and configuration management tools.


Required Skills & Qualifications:

  • Bachelor’s degree in Computer Science, IT, or related field.

  • 3+ years of experience in DevOps, Infrastructure, or Cloud Engineering.

  • Strong experience with cloud platforms (AWS, Azure, or GCP).

  • Proficiency in scripting languages (Bash, Python, or PowerShell).

  • Hands-on experience with CI/CD tools (Jenkins, GitHub Actions, GitLab CI/CD).

  • Experience with Infrastructure as Code tools (Terraform preferred).

  • Knowledge of containerization (Docker) and orchestration (Kubernetes).

  • Familiarity with monitoring and logging tools.

  • Understanding of networking concepts, security, and system administration.


Preferred Qualifications:

  • Certifications like AWS Certified DevOps Engineer, Azure DevOps Engineer, or Kubernetes certifications.

  • Experience with microservices architecture.

  • Knowledge of configuration management tools (Ansible, Chef, Puppet).

  • Experience with serverless architectures and cloud-native solutions.


Soft Skills:

  • Strong problem-solving and analytical skills

  • Excellent communication and collaboration abilities

  • Ability to work in a fast-paced, agile environment

  • Attention to detail and proactive mindset

             

Similar Jobs you may be interested in ..